在Linux系统中,默认的rmem参数值是87380。这个数值是经过系统优化后的结果,可以满足大多数网络场景下的需求。但是在一些特定的网络环境中,这个默认值可能会显得不够用。比如在高强度的网络负载情况下,接收端缓冲区不足可能导致数据丢失或者网络不稳定。因此,有时候需要手动调整rmem参数的数值。
在Linux系统中,可以通过修改/proc/sys/net/core/rmem_default文件来设置rmem参数的数值。通过命令行输入以下命令即可修改默认值:
```
echo 1048576 > /proc/sys/net/core/rmem_default
```
上面的命令将rmem参数的默认值修改为1MB。在具体调整数值时,可以根据网络负载和需求来进行调整。一般来说,可以先设置一个较大的值,然后观察网络状况,逐步逼近最优数值。
需要注意的是,修改rmem参数的数值需要谨慎,过大的数值可能会导致内存资源浪费。在设置时一定要结合实际情况和需求来进行调整。
总的来说,Linux系统中的rmem参数是一个关键的网络性能调优参数,可以通过适当的调整来提升网络通信的性能和稳定性。通过合理设置rmem参数值,可以更好地适应不同的网络环境和需求,提升系统的整体性能。